Treasure Island
In a seaside town in England, young Jim Hawkins keeps the Admiral Benbow Inn together with his mother. His adventure begins the moment a map to Treasure Island falls into his hands. Setting sail after the treasure with Dr. Livesey and the others, what awaits him is the harsh law of the sea, a band of merry seafaring men like John Silver — and betrayal. Through the struggle against the pirates who had slipped aboard disguised as crewmen, Jim comes to learn how very differently these men live their lives: Silver, Gray, and the rest.

E1
Billy the terrible has arrived!
A mysterious lodger turns up at the Admiral Benbow Inn, which Jim runs with his mother. Calling himself Billy, the man seems frightened of something and drinks like a fish. When Jim grows suspicious, Billy asks him to keep watch for a one‑legged man. Who is this one‑legged man, and what is Billy so afraid of?

E2
Black Dog… What's That?!
A man called Black Dog, an old shipmate, comes looking for Billy — but the moment he spots him, he attacks. In the scuffle, Billy collapses from a stroke. When Dr. Livesey rolls up Billy's sleeve to treat him, he finds a pirate's tattoo — Billy was a pirate all along…!

E3
The Crutch Comes Down
A man calling himself Blind Pew appears before Billy and hands him the Black Spot — the pirates' notice of severance, a sentence of death. Terrified to learn the one‑legged man will come at ten that night, Billy keeps drinking until a stroke finally kills him. Jim is left stunned — and the appointed hour draws nearer by the minute.
